Context apprehension only occurs when you feel anxious only in certain situations, as some individuals may respond psychologically to certain situations where there is an apprehension of communication, which causes negative emotions such as anxiety or stress.

Context apprehension  occur in situations where the individual may feel judged or observed, such as:

  • Job interview.
  • Speak in public.
  • Work meeting.

To reduce the apprehension of the context, it is necessary for the individual to recognize the moments of communication where he feels the triggers of anxiety and seek understanding for the reasons that lead him to feel such emotions.

There are several physical activities that also contribute to quality mental health, such as yoga, running and meditation.

It is also essential to seek specialized help, such as a therapist, to help reduce these symptoms, as pathological anxiety and stress directly impact the individual's quality of life, which can lead to further disorders and the development of other illnesses such as panic syndrome and depression.
